+/*
+ * The constants AT_REMOVEDIR and AT_EACCESS have the same value.  AT_EACCESS is
+ * meaningful only to faccessat, while AT_REMOVEDIR is meaningful only to
+ * unlinkat.  The two functions do completely different things and therefore,
+ * the flags can be allowed to overlap.  For example, passing AT_REMOVEDIR to
+ * faccessat would be undefined behavior and thus treating it equivalent to
+ * AT_EACCESS is valid undefined behavior.
+ */
 #define AT_FDCWD		-100    /* Special value used to indicate
                                            openat should use the current
                                            working directory. */
 #define AT_SYMLINK_NOFOLLOW	0x100   /* Do not follow symbolic links.  */
+#define AT_EACCESS		0x200	/* Test access permitted for
+                                           effective IDs, not real IDs.  */
 #define AT_REMOVEDIR		0x200   /* Remove directory instead of
                                            unlinking file.  */
 #define AT_SYMLINK_FOLLOW	0x400   /* Follow symbolic links.  */

@@ -1,6 +1,10 @@
 #!/bin/sh
 # S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
 # description: %HERE DESCRIBE WHAT THIS DOES%
+# requires: %HERE LIST THE REQUIRED FILES, TRACERS OR README-STRINGS%
+# The required tracer needs :tracer suffix, e.g. function:tracer
+# The required README string needs :README suffix, e.g. "x8/16/32/64":README
+# and the README string is treated as a fixed-string instead of regexp pattern.
 # you have to add ".tc" extention for your testcase file
 # Note that all tests are run with "errexit" option.
